Localize the Source: Tools and Techniques for Plumbers

Locating the source of a water leak under your floor is a crucial step for any plumber, whether they’re handling commercial plumbing issues or residential plumbing services. They’ll employ various tools and techniques to navigate this hidden problem. This might include using moisture meters to detect areas with abnormal humidity levels, which can pinpoint the exact location of the leak. Visual inspection with cameras is another powerful tool, allowing plumbers to see inside walls and floors to identify cracks, pipes, or fittings that may be the culprit.
For hotel plumbing systems or any complex setup, specialized equipment like pressure gauges and flow meters might be employed to track water movement and pressure changes, helping to zero in on the leak’s origin. Once located, these skilled professionals can then employ targeted repair methods, ensuring not just the immediate stop of water loss but also long-term solutions that prevent future leaks, keeping your space safe from damage and waste.
Understand Common Causes of Under-Floor Leaks

Leaks under your floor can be frustrating and costly to fix, especially if they’re caused by issues that could have been prevented. Understanding the common causes is a crucial first step for any commercial property owner or manager. One of the primary culprits is outdated or damaged pipes, particularly in older buildings where corrosion and wear and tear are more prevalent. Another frequent problem is faulty fixtures or fittings, such as broken washermen or misaligned showerheads, which can lead to persistent drips that eventually manifest as floor leaks.
